Protein Quality and Completeness
Both soy and chicken are considered high-quality proteins because they contain all nine essential amino acids necessary for the body's functions, including muscle repair and growth. However, there are subtle differences in their amino acid profiles. Animal proteins generally have a higher concentration of the amino acid leucine, which is a key trigger for muscle protein synthesis. Research shows that to achieve the same muscle-building response, a higher quantity of soy protein may be needed compared to whey protein, a common dairy-based animal protein. While soy is a complete protein, its relative bioavailability is slightly lower than animal-based proteins due to factors like fiber and anti-nutritional compounds present in plants. This does not mean soy is ineffective for muscle building, merely that larger quantities might be needed to reach the same threshold for stimulation.
Bioavailability and Nutrient Absorption
The concept of bioavailability refers to how efficiently the body can absorb and utilize nutrients from a food source. Studies have indicated that animal-based proteins, including chicken, tend to have higher overall bioavailability than plant-based sources. Chicken meat also contains heme-iron, which is more readily absorbed by the body than the nonheme iron found in soy. Furthermore, key nutrients like vitamin B12 and vitamin D are naturally abundant in chicken but are not present in useful amounts in soy products unless they are fortified. Zinc is another mineral more easily absorbed from animal protein sources.
Vitamins and Minerals
Here is a list of some key vitamins and minerals where one protein source has a notable advantage:
- Chicken Advantages
- Vitamin B12: Crucial for nerve function and DNA production.
- Vitamin D: Essential for bone health and immune function.
- Niacin (Vitamin B3): Higher amounts found in chicken.
- Selenium: An important antioxidant present in higher levels.
- Soy Advantages
- Manganese: Significant levels present.
- Copper: Abundant in soybeans.
- Magnesium: Soybeans have more magnesium than chicken.
- Iron: While soy contains iron, it is nonheme and less bioavailable than the heme-iron in chicken.
Health Benefits and Dietary Impact
Beyond the basic protein comparison, the overall health impact of each source is a crucial factor. Soy protein, being plant-based, is inherently free of cholesterol and low in saturated fat, making it a heart-friendly option. Its high fiber content aids in digestion and promotes a feeling of fullness, which can be beneficial for weight management. Soy also contains unique compounds called isoflavones, which function as antioxidants and have been linked to a reduced risk of certain cancers and improved cardiovascular health by lowering 'bad' LDL cholesterol.
Conversely, lean chicken breast is a low-calorie, high-protein source with zero carbohydrates. It is a versatile and complete protein for many dietary patterns. However, certain cuts of chicken can be higher in saturated fat, which should be considered, though lean chicken is a solid, healthy choice. The main health concern with meat consumption generally revolves around potential higher fat content and environmental impact, neither of which are inherent to lean chicken breast itself.
A Closer Look: Soy vs. Chicken Comparison Table
| Feature | Soy Protein | Chicken Protein |
|---|---|---|
| Protein Quality | Complete (contains all essential amino acids) | Complete (contains all essential amino acids) |
| Bioavailability | Slightly lower than animal protein due to fiber | Higher than most plant proteins |
| Fiber Content | Rich in dietary fiber | Contains no fiber |
| Saturated Fat | Low, cholesterol-free | Low in lean cuts, higher in others |
| Heart Health | Beneficial (can lower LDL cholesterol) | Neutral (dependent on cut and preparation) |
| Key Vitamins | High in Folate, Vitamin K | High in B vitamins (B3, B5, B12) |
| Key Minerals | High in Iron (nonheme), Copper, Magnesium, Manganese | High in Iron (heme), Zinc, Selenium |
| Unique Compounds | Isoflavones (antioxidants) | None comparable |
| Environmental Impact | Generally lower carbon footprint | Higher environmental footprint |
Cost and Environmental Considerations
For many, cost is a significant factor. While prices fluctuate, processed soy products like textured vegetable protein (TVP) are often more affordable per gram of protein than chicken. A 2025 YouTube video found that one kilogram of soy chunks could yield significantly more protein than one kilogram of skinless chicken for a comparable price.
The environmental impact is also a key differentiator. The production of chicken, and animal products in general, has a larger carbon footprint and requires more resources like land and water compared to soy production. While soy is a major component of chicken feed, its direct consumption bypasses the resource-intensive animal agriculture step. This makes soy a more sustainable option for those concerned about their environmental impact. Conclusion: Making the Right Choice for You
In the final analysis, there is no single 'better' option; the choice between soy protein and chicken depends on your specific health goals, dietary restrictions, and ethical or environmental concerns. If you are focused on maximizing muscle protein synthesis and absorbing specific micronutrients like Vitamin B12 and heme-iron, lean chicken offers a slight edge in bioavailability. However, for those prioritizing heart health, weight management, increased fiber intake, or minimizing environmental impact, soy protein is an excellent and comparable alternative. A balanced, varied diet that incorporates both plant and animal proteins, or a careful plant-based diet that ensures all nutrient needs are met, is a perfectly valid and healthy approach.
